Emmanuel Mayumbelo

Head-credit Origination Corporate And Commercial Banking at FNB Zambia

Emmanuel Mayumbelo has extensive work experience in the banking industry. Emmanuel began their career at Access Bank Zambia in 2011 as a Money Market Dealer in the Treasury department. Emmanuel was responsible for managing domestic treasury activities and ensuring compliance with banking regulations.

In 2010, Emmanuel joined Stanbic Bank Zambia as a Manager in the Trade Finance Specialist role. Emmanuel focused on credit risk management by verifying key documents, maintaining control over physical stock counts, and providing support to stakeholders. Emmanuel later transitioned to the role of Credit Risk Officer in the Agric department, where they implemented credit procedures and managed advance administration to contain credit risk.

Emmanuel also worked as a Business Banker at Stanbic Bank Zambia, where they grew and retained a portfolio of high-value SME relationships. Emmanuel provided customized financial solutions and identified sales leads for associate company stakeholders.

At FNB Zambia, Emmanuel served as the Head of Credit Origination in the Corporate and Commercial Banking division. Emmanuel led a team of credit origination managers, specialists, and analysts, supporting business segments and achieving lending goals. Emmanuel assessed and approved credit lending, set covenants, and ensured compliance with excess policy and expired limit processes.

In 2019, Emmanuel joined Stanbic Bank as a Senior Credit Evaluation Manager in the Agribusiness and Commercial department. Emmanuel assessed and managed counterparty credit risks associated with lending and investing activities.

Overall, Emmanuel Mayumbelo has significant experience in credit risk management, trade finance, business banking, and treasury operations within the banking industry.

From 2005 to 2008, Emmanuel Mayumbelo attended Cavendish University, where they obtained a Bachelor of Business Administration (B.B.A.) degree with a field of study in Business Administration and Management. Following this, from 2011 to 2023, Emmanuel enrolled at Edinburgh Business School – Heriot Watts University (UK) as a student pursuing a Master's in Business Administration (MBA) with a specialization in Finance and Strategic Planning.
